TX 2000 is the state of the art laboratory spectrometer for quantitative multi element trace analysis using principles of Total Reflection X-Ray Fluorescence (TXRF).
TXRF, based on the same principles of traditional X-Ray Fluorescence (XRF), minimizes or totally eliminates matrix effect, allows simoultaneius multi-element ultra-trace analysis and pushes the instrumental detection limit down to ppb range from sodium to plutonium.
TX 2000, equipped with an automatic primary beam switching system (MoKa, WLa/Lb and bremsstrahlung 33 keV), a Silicon Drift Detector and an high power X-Ray Tube is the optimal solution for applications in environmentalm chemicals and nuclear fields.

Software:
MODERN SAX - Acquisition Software
Written for Windows 7 is the program designed for the control of the TX 2000 System. It includes some new features, like the batch programming of a set of measurements. The program can control different kinds of detectors and devices attached to the instrument. Control panels for scintillation, linear position sensitive detectors and XRF X-GLAB SDD detector are integrated.
